MKP1G023303F00J Series
High-voltage film capacitors for electronic circuits
The MKP1G023303F00J series from WIMA is a line of high-voltage film capacitors designed for use in electronic circuits that require robust performance under high voltage conditions. These capacitors are commonly found in power supplies, inverters, and other applications where maintaining stability and reliability over a wide range of voltages is crucial.
One thing worth noting is their ability to handle high voltages without degrading quickly. Engineers tend to reach for these when they need components that can operate reliably in high-tension environments, such as in switching power supplies or in industrial control systems. The series is known for its stability and longevity, making it a popular choice for applications where voltage fluctuations are common.
Another practical observation is their compact size and low profile, which makes them suitable for space-constrained designs. They offer a good balance between capacitance value and physical footprint, allowing for efficient board layout in dense circuit boards.
